Therefore My people go into exile for their lack of knowledge; And their honorable men are famished, And their multitude is parched with thirst.
Therefore Sheol has enlarged its throat and opened its mouth without measure; And Jerusalem's splendor, her multitude, her din of revelry and the jubilant within her, descend into it.
So the common man will be humbled and the man of importance abased, The eyes of the proud also will be abased.
But the LORD of hosts will be exalted in judgment, And the holy God will show Himself holy in righteousness.
Then the lambs will graze as in their pasture, And strangers will eat in the waste places of the wealthy.
Woe to those who drag iniquity with the cords of falsehood, And sin as if with cart ropes;
Who say, "Let Him make speed, let Him hasten His work, that we may see it; And let the purpose of the Holy One of Israel draw near And come to pass, that we may know it!"
